New Hampshire LLC Costs

Last updated: March 18th, 2024
We might receive compensation from the companies whose products we review. We are independently owned and the opinions here are our own.

Recommended LLC Services

4.5\5
  • Set up LLC without hassle
  • Take you through all steps
  • Start your LLC worry-free
5\5
  • Same day filing service
  • Affordable pricing
  • Strict ethical code
4.6\5
  • Full Registered Agent service
  • Helps obtain business licenses and permits
  • Next-business-day processing

An LLC, or limited liability company, is a business stricture that gives business owners better liability protection, unique tax benefits, and an optimal management structure. Some business owners believe that LLC formation in New Hampshire is overly complicated and expensive. However, it is pretty affordable and worth the time and cost over time.

Jump to

Costs to start an LLC in New Hampshire

1
LLC Certificate of Formation ($100)

2
New Hampshire annual report fee ($100)

  • In New Hampshire, you must file an annual report.
  • You will file your New Hampshire annual report online using the NH QuickStart website.
  • Your New Hampshire LLC annual report must be submitted by April 1 every year.
  • Failure to pay your annual fee on time will result in a $50 penalty, and you could face LLC dissolution.

3
New Hampshire registered agent fee (varies between $50 to $300)

  • When forming an LLC in New Hampshire, you must appoint a registered agent.
  • You are letting the New Hampshire Department of State know that someone is available during business hours to accept subpoenas, tax notices, and other correspondence.
  • Your LLC cannot act as its own registered agent. However, you as an individual can.
  • The cost for a registered agent for your LLC will vary depending on the service or individual to choose, your LLC needs, and the state filing fees.

4
Fees to form a foreign LLC in New Hampshire ($100)

  • If you have an existing LLC in another state and want to expand, you will need to register your LLC as a New Hampshire Foreign LLC.
  • You must file an Application for Foreign Limited Liability Company Registration (Form FLLC-1) through the New Hampshire QuickStart portal.
  • The LLC filing fee to register a New Hampshire foreign LLC is $100.

5
LLC name reservation fee ($15)

  • New Hampshire does not require you to reserve an LLC name as long as it is available when you start LLC formation.
  • Reserving an LLC name ensures that another company does not obtain and use it.
  • You can reserve a New Hampshire LLC name for up to 120 days.
  • You must complete LLC Name Reservation (Form 1) online using the NH QuickStart website.
  • The cost for reserving a New Hampshire LLC name is $15.

6
DBA filing fees in New Hampshire ($50)

  • The business acronym DBA stands for ‘doing business as.’ A DBA, or an assumed name, is any registered name a company or individual uses to do business that is not its legal name.
  • You must register a DBA name in New Hampshire if the business name is not the name of the LLC.
  • You must complete the Application for Registration of Trade Name (Form TN-1) online using the NH QuickStart website.
  • The cost for a New Hampshire DBA is $50.

7
Cost of certified document copies ($5)

  • You will order New Hampshire certified copies of LLC documents through the NH QuickStart portal.
  • A certified LLC document in New Hampshire costs $5 and $1 per page.
  • New Hampshire does offer an expedited process for $30 plus $1 per page.

8
Certificate of Good Standing ($7 online)

  • Banking institutions and lenders will require a New Hampshire Certificate of Good Standing before allowing you to open a business banking account in the state.
  • You can order your Certificate of Good Standing online using the NH QuickStart website.
  • Or, you can contact the New Hampshire Secretary of State Corporation Division for instructions on how to submit by mail or in person.
  • The filing cost for a Certificate of Good Standing in New Hampshire is $7 online and $5 by mail or in person.

Steps to start an LLC in New Hampshire

1
Choose a business name

In New Hampshire, you will need to consider a few things when choosing an LLC name.

You will use the NH QuickStart website to conduct a name search for LLC name availability.

LLC name reservation fee

You do not have to reserve a New Hampshire LLC name before the formation process.

An LLC name reservation is good for up to 120 days in New Hampshire.

You must complete LLC Name Reservation (Form 1) online.

The cost for reserving a New Hampshire LLC name is $15.

The cost for reserving an New Hampshire LLC name is 15, and is good for up to 120 days. New Hampshire does not require you to reserve an LLC name.

2
Appoint a New Hampshire registered agent

In New Hampshire, you must appoint a registered agent to form an LLC in the state.

The price for a New Hampshire registered agent or service varies beetween $50 and $100 a year. The cost depends on the state and your LLC needs.

A registered agent in New Hampshire is an individual or business entity that receives tax forms, legal documents, subpoenas, civil notices, service of process, and other official government correspondence on behalf of a sole proprietorship, corporation, or LLC.

The registered agent you choose must be a New Hampshire resident or a registered agent service authorized to conduct business in the state.

ZenBusiness

  • Starter Plan – $39 a year plus State Fees
  • Pro Plan – $149 a year plus State Fees
  • Premium Plan – $249 a year plus State Fees

ZenBusiness offers a stand-alone registered agent service. The price is $99 per year.

Northwest

  • Total Out The Door New Hampshire LLC Formation Service Package – $45 a month and includes:
    • New Hampshire State Fee
    • Filing Service Fee
    • Registered Agent
    • Tax ID
  • Annual Plan – $225 plus State Fees a year

LegalZoom

  • Economy – $79 plus $153 New Hampshire filing fees
  • Standard – $329 plus $153 state filing fees
  • Express Gold – $349 plus $255 state filing fees

3
File New Hampshire Certificate of Formation

You must file your LLC Certificate of Formation with the New Hampshire Department of State.

You can submit your Certificate of Formation online using the NH QuickStart website.

Or, you can complete the Certificate of Formation New Hampshire Limited Liability form (Form LLC-1) form.

The cost to file your LLC Certificate of Formation is $100.

New Hampshire only offers expected services for faxed filings and walk-ins. You will need to contact the Department of State for questions regarding the price and process of expedited services.

Mailing address:
Corporation Division, NH Dept. of State
107 N Main St, Rm 204
Concord, NH 03301

Form LLC-1 will ask you for specific information about the New Hampshire LLC.

  • LLC name and address
  • Nature of your LLC business
  • Registered agent information
  • The name of at least one LLC manager or member

The fee in New Hampshire for filing your LLC Certificate of Formation is $100.

4
Get a New Hampshire LLC EIN

An Employer Identification Number, or EIN, can also be referred to as a Federal Employer Identification Number (FEIN) or Federal Tax ID Number (FTIN).

An EIN is a 9-digit number that acts like a social security number for companies for income tax purposes. The IRS, or Internal Revenue Service, issues EINs for free.

If converting a sole proprietorship to a New Hampshire LLC, you will need to apply for an EIN.

Applying for an EIN is a simple process online through the IRS website.

Business banking for a New Hampshire LLC

It is always recommended that you keep your personal banking account and business banking accounts separate. It protects your assets and credit scores.

In New Hampshire, a bank will require your Certificate of Formation, an operating agreement, and your federally assigned EIN.

Business banking accounts are generally free, and do not have additional charges or fees.

Business attorney fees in New Hampshire

Hiring a business attorney will help guide you through the LLC formation process. It makes it more manageable, and you have someone that can help handle future business-related issues.

A business attorney will likely offer you a free consultation if you are a first-time client.

Professional services such as LegalZoom and Rocket Lawyer offer LLC formation packages that include comprehensive legal services.

On average, a business lawyer in New Hampshire will cost $300 per hour.

LLC taxes in New Hampshire

  • In New Hampshire, an LLC is a pass-through entity. It means the member will file their personal tax returns rather than the LLC’s state tax returns.
  • New Hampshire is one of five states that do not have a state sales tax.
  • LLCs with gross receipts of more than $500,00 will have a flat 8.2% tax. It is an annual tax due on the 15th day of the third month after the close of the tax year.
  • New Hampshire has a Business Enterprise Tax. It usually requires an accountant to decipher the exact amount of tax. The New Hampshire Department of Revenue website has complete information about the business tax.
  • You will incur a $50 penalty for Business Enterprise Tax late filings.
  • You must register for Unemployment Insurance Tax with the New Hampshire Employment Security for LLCs with employees.
  • New Hampshire state taxes are complicated, especially the Business Enterprise Tax. You will benefit from hiring a tax accountant to avoid fines and penalties.

Business licenses and permits in New Hampshire

The New Hampshire business licenses and permits you will need will depend on where your LLC is located and the type of business.

You will use the NH.gov Business website to search for the specific licensees and permit you to require.

A business license in New Hampshire is between $100 and $140 . The price for local permits and licenses will depend on where you are located and the type of business it is.

All New Hampshire counties and towns will have different rules and requirements for permits and licenses. You will want to contact the office beforehand to ask about the process, price, and business hours.

Notary public

You may come across LLC documents in New Hampshire requiring a notary public.

Most government offices have a notary on staff if you cannot find one.

According to New Hampshire, a notary public can only charge a max of $10 per notorial act.

Employer obligations in New Hampshire

Benefits of a New Hampshire LLC

  • You are simplifying business banking when you form an LLC in New Hampshire. Banks and lenders will require that you open a business bank account that is separate from the personal accounts. It offers you liability protection in the future.
  • LLCs have different compliance requirements than other business structures. Incorporations answer to shareholders and stock owners when making business decisions, while LLCs do not.
  • A New Hampshire LLC is a pass-through entity. Your LLC earnings are only taxed once through your personal tax returns.
  • Forming an LLC in New Hampshire helps reduce your chance of double-taxation. C-corporations, for instance, are double taxed. LLCs are not.
  • New Hampshire LLC formation fees are more affordable than in many states. It only costs $100 to file your Certificate of Formation.

FAQs

How long does it take to register an LLC in New Hampshire?

In New Hampshire, it will take 3 to 7 business days to process an LLC online and up to 3 weeks if you file by mail.

There are expected services available if you file by fax or in person.

How do I dissolve my New Hampshire LLC?

You must dissolve your LLC to avoid ongoing costs. You will file your Articles of Dissolution with the NH Department of State. You can file online or complete the form and submit it by mail.

The filing fee for your LLC cancellation is $35.

Are there publication requirements for an LLC in New Hampshire?

Unlike Arizona, New Hampshire does not require any further publication requirements outside of your annual report.

However, you take advantage of advertisements when you publish your new LLC. It helps new companies, small businesses, and entrepreneurs introduce themselves to the public.

Does New Hampshire have an annual franchise tax?

New Hampshire does not have a franchise registration fee or an annual franchise tax.

Find out how much it costs to start an LLC in your state

Click below to get started.

Back to top